I went ahead and installed everything but now when I use the XWin
Server shortcut, I get a window that covers the Windows desktop,
titled pcmanfm. The xdg system tray icon also starts, along with the
"Cygwin/X Server:0.0" system-tray icon.
The desktop window contains a desktop, with a trash-can and a
background wallpaper that says LXDE.
I've installed the X server component before, but usually, when I
start the XWin Server, the two system-tray icons start, but nothing
else. At install-time, I didn't select any options for a specific
desktop, at least I don't think I did.
I've looked into the documentation to see why this happens, but I have
no user-specific X startup files that I can see:
$ ls -la
-rw-r--r-- .bash_history
-rw-r--r-- .bash_profile
-rw-r--r-- .bashrc
drwxr-xr-x .cache/
drwxr-xr-x .config/
drwxr-xr-x .dbus/
drwxr-xr-x .dbus-keyrings/
drwxr-xr-x .gnupg/
-rw-r--r-- .ICEauthority
-rw-r--r-- .inputrc
-rw-r--r-- .lesshst
drwxr-xr-x .local/
-rw-r--r-- .minttyrc
-rw-r--r-- .profile
drwxr-xr-x .ssh/
-rw-r--r-- .Xauthority
drwxr-xr-x Desktop/
Is there a way to disable the full-desktop startup, so that only the
the X Server and xdg menu start?
